1. Take Current Photos of Your Roof
Most people don’t have a photo of their roof until an insurance adjuster asks for one.
Before storm season:
Walk around your home and take wide-angle photos from every side
Capture roof lines, valleys, flashing, gutters, vents and skylights
If safe, use a drone or hire a professional inspection company for overhead photos
Save the date stamped images somewhere secure
Why????
Helps prove storm-related damage versus pre-existing wear
Creates a visual baseline for insurance
Can speed up claims and reduce disputes
2. Save Records of Repairs and Maintenance
Small repairs matter more than homeowners realize.
Document:
Roof repairs
Gutter cleanings
Flashing repairs
Chimney work
Sheet metal work
Vent replacements
Tree trimming near the home
Keep:
Invoices/Receipts
Contractor names
Photos of completed work
Warranty information
Insurance companies often look at maintenance history when reviewing claims. Organized records help show the home was properly maintained before the storm.
3. Photograph Your Siding, Windows, Gutters and Exterior
Storm damage doesn’t stop at the roof.
Take photos of:
Siding
Window trim
Gutters and downspouts
Fence lines
Exterior HVAC units
Decks and patios
Garage doors
Hail and wind damage can affect multiple parts of a property at once. Having “before” photos gives you leverage if damage is questioned later.
4. Create a Simple Home Inventory
Most homeowners underestimate how much personal property they own until water enters the house.
Walk room-by-room and document:
Electronics
Appliances
Furniture
Jewelry
Collectibles
Tools
Home office equipment
Quick tip:
A simple phone video walking through your house can be incredibly valuable after a loss.

5. Know the Age of Your Roof
One of the first questions insurance companies ask is:
“How old is the roof?”
If you don’t know:
Find old invoices
Request records from previous contractors
Ask your realtor if you recently purchased the home
Have a roofing company inspect it
Knowing:
Roof material
Installation date
Warranty information
Repair history
can make the claims process run smoother.
6. Check Your Attic Before Storm Season
Your attic tells so much about your roof!
Before storms arrive:
Look for water stains
Check for mold or musty smells
Inspect insulation for damp areas
Look for daylight coming through boards
Minor leaks often start long before homeowners notice ceiling stains inside the living space.
